Turkey Cranberry Sliders

Sure, we like Thanksgiving food, but do you know what we like more? The leftovers! Put the leftover turkey, cranberry sauce, and buns to good use with these Turkey Cranberry Sliders. Add a little Havarti cheese and you have yourself a nice little post-Thanksgiving lunch!
Servings 6
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es

Ingredients

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F. Line a large ba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Slice each slider bun in half, leaving a connecting hinge piece of bread so they open like a book.
  • Place a slice of turkey meat onto each bun and line them up in neat rows on the baking pan.
  • Add a spoonful of cranberry sauce on top of each piece of turkey.
  • Tear the Havarti cheese into quarters and put two square quarters over the cranberry sauce. Close the slider buns.
  • In a small bowl, mix together the melted butter, Dijon mustard, Member's Mark™ Onion Powder, and Worcestershire sauce in a small bowl. Brush the butter mixture evenly over the top of the sliders. Sprinkle the tops with Einstein Bros® Everything Bagel Seasoning, if desired.
  • Bake for 10 - 12 minutes, or until the tops are golden brown and the cheese has melted.
